"Witch Light" is the latest novel by Susan Fletcher, known for her bestsellers "Eve Green" and "Oystercatchers." The story is set in 1692 and follows the young Corrag, who is imprisoned as a witch in Scotland. In her cold and dirty cell, she awaits the cruel fate of being burned at the stake. However, when the young Irishman Charles Leslie visits her, a chance arises for Corrag to tell her story. She was a witness to the bloody massacre at Glencoe and has much to share. Her narrative is filled with passion, courage, magic, and betrayal, illustrating how the actions of an individual can influence the great events of history.
